Best Neighborhoods in Maple Grove for New Construction Buyers

Evanswood

• One of Maple Grove’s newer residential communities with modern single-family homes
• Homes typically range from about $550,000 to $850,000 depending on size, builder, and upgrades
• Known for spacious homesites and newer construction designs
• Popular with buyers looking for quiet suburban living while still being close to Maple Grove’s retail and dining areas

Rush Hollow

• Growing community featuring newer construction homes with contemporary layouts
• Many homes range roughly from $500,000 to $800,000 depending on builder and square footage
• Attractive to buyers who want modern homes with open-concept floorplans and new amenities
• Convenient access to major commuter routes including I-94

Greenswest

• Established neighborhood that includes newer homes and desirable residential streets
• Homes often range from approximately $450,000 to $750,000 depending on size and updates
• Close to parks, schools, and local shopping areas
• Popular for buyers seeking a quieter neighborhood feel while still being near Maple Grove amenities

These neighborhoods are attractive to new construction buyers because they offer newer homes, community amenities, and convenient access to shopping, restaurants, parks, and major commuting routes throughout Maple Grove.

FAQs

What is the average price of new construction homes in Maple Grove, MN?

Most new construction homes in Maple Grove typically range between $450,000 and $900,000 depending on the builder, home size, and lot location.

Do I need a real estate agent when buying new construction?

Yes. The builder’s sales representative represents the builder. Having your own agent ensures someone is advocating for your interests during the contract, upgrades, and inspection process.

How long does it take to build a new home in Maple Grove?

Most new construction homes take approximately 6 to 10 months to complete, depending on the builder, weather, and stage of construction at the time of purchase.

Is Maple Grove a good area for new construction buyers?

Yes. Maple Grove continues to grow with new communities, strong schools, parks, and shopping areas like Arbor Lakes, making it one of the most popular suburbs in the Twin Cities for new homes.
